Ok, I had my Stoptech stainless steel brake lines installed today along with dot 4 fluid (oem is dot 3). I am happy to say the pedal feel is a lot better, shorter travel and more firm. Here are some pics of my car, the install and ONE of the installers Lexus.
My now updated mods list -
RSR Best*i coilovers
Figs LCA bushings in the bracket
Titan7 Forged 19" wheels w Michelin ps4s tires
Ultra Racing - front upper strut tower bar, front 4 point subframe brace, front lower tie bar, mid 3 point subframe brace, front lower tunnel brace, rear 2 point subframe brace, rear lateral braces
Toms Racing - rear upper strut tower bar, rear lower tunnel brace
SuperPro rear sway bar
Hard race front sway bar
Borla axleback
AFE drop in air filter w HPS intake arm
Stoptech SS brake lines w Project Mu pads
Nizo Low front lip
